Public Transportation: Your Gateway to Exploration

The Port Authority of Allegheny County (PAT), the primary public transportation provider in Pittsburgh, offers a variety of services that cater to students' needs. Buses and light rail lines, known as the "T," connect various parts of the city, making it convenient to reach classes, explore different neighborhoods, and access entertainment venues.

Student Discounts: Making Public Transportation Affordable

PAT recognizes the financial constraints of students and offers discounted fares for those with valid college IDs. Simply present your student ID when purchasing a ticket or pass to access these reduced rates.

Student Pass: A Convenient Option for University of Pittsburgh Students

The University of Pittsburgh collaborates with PAT to offer a student pass specifically for their students. This pass provides unlimited rides on all PAT buses and light rail lines, making it a cost-effective and convenient choice for those enrolled at the university.

Bike Sharing: A Sustainable and Active Way to Get Around

Pittsburgh boasts a growing network of bike-sharing programs, providing students with an eco-friendly and active way to navigate the city. Stations strategically located throughout the city make it easy to pick up and drop off bikes, allowing students to explore neighborhoods, visit attractions, and enjoy scenic routes.
